WPDX D+X Inverted Drive Cast Iron Worm Reducer — Product Overview

Ceiling-mounted and inverted overhead drive applications demand two things beyond the standard WPX: direct motor mounting without an adaptor plate, and maintenance access without bringing the unit down from the ceiling. The WPDX delivers both. The integrated IEC motor flange eliminates the adaptor. The D-type split housing allows the cover to be removed and the worm wheel inspected while the unit remains ceiling-mounted and the motor stays connected.

Output torques up to 3,025 Nm across 12 standard sizes make the WPDX the reference choice for overhead mining conveyors, industrial process line ceiling drives, and hanging drive systems where maintenance accessibility and direct motor mounting are both required.

WPDX Worm Reducer Specifications

WPDX worm reducer dimension drawing inverted D-split downward output

Parameter Specification
Series Single Speed
Housing Structure Separate split cast iron (D-type)
Input Configuration IEC motor flange — horizontal, bilateral (D-type)
Output Configuration Solid shaft — vertical downward (X-type)
Reduction Ratio 1/5–1/60
Centre Distance 40–250 mm
Mounting Inverted/ceiling foot-mount, D-split, IEC flange, downward output
Housing Material FC20+ grey cast iron (GG20)
Worm Wheel Material Tin-bronze ZCuSn10Pb1
Worm Shaft Material 20CrMnTi, 55–60 HRC surface
Lubrication N220–N320 (−30°C–40°C); N320–N460 (40°C–65°C)
Max Oil Temperature 95°C continuous
Weight Range 5–396 kg
Special Feature D+X: IEC motor flange + vertical downward output + D-split housing maintenance access

WPDX Worm Reducer — Core Features

■ X-Type Downward Output — Purpose-Built Inverted Drive

Vertical downward output shaft is standard — no inverted mounting kit, no right-angle adapter. Mount the housing ceiling-up, output shaft points directly to the driven equipment below.

■ D-Type Split Housing — Ceiling-Position Maintenance

Cover removal in the ceiling-mounted position without lowering the unit. Worm wheel access with motor still connected and unit still on the ceiling structure — critical for reducing planned maintenance downtime.

■ IEC Motor Flange — No Adaptor Plate Required

Integrated IEC 72-1 flange eliminates the motor adaptor from the overhead drive BOM. Four motor bolts, drive complete — no coupling, no alignment, no adaptor fabrication.

■ Output Torque to 3,025 Nm — Same as WPDA

D+X configuration does not affect worm gear capacity. WPDX size 250 delivers 850–3,025 Nm identical to the WPDA.

■ FC20+ Cast Iron — Rigid Under Inverted Load

Cast iron housing maintains dimensional stability in inverted ceiling-mount configurations under the sustained weight of the drive unit and motor — aluminium housings can creep under long-term overhead load.

■ Weight 5–396 kg, 12 Sizes

From compact size 40 (5 kg) to heavy-duty size 250 (396 kg) — the full industrial overhead drive power range in a single WPDX product series.

Frequently Asked Questions — WPDX Worm Reducer

▶ How does WPDX differ from the WPX?
The WPX uses a solid input shaft and one-piece housing. The WPDX adds D-type split housing (in-situ maintenance access) and integrated IEC motor flange (no adaptor plate), while retaining the X-type vertical downward output. Three functions versus one.
▶ Can the WPDX be serviced in the ceiling-mount inverted position?
Yes — the D-type split housing allows cover removal without inverting the unit. The split line is designed so the top cover (which faces down in inverted installation) can be removed to access the worm wheel while the motor flange joint remains intact.
▶ What is the oil circuit arrangement for WPDX X-type inverted mounting?
In X-type inverted mounting with output shaft down, the oil sump geometry changes. Use the WPDX lubrication table for the correct oil volume — it differs from horizontal WPDA orientation to maintain worm wheel lubrication coverage.
▶ Does the WPDX IEC flange accept the same motor frames as the WPDA?
Yes. The IEC 72-1 flange accepts A02/Y-series motor flanges at the same frame size ranges as the WPDA: sizes 40–80 accept frames 56–130; sizes 100–135 accept frames 130–200; sizes 155–250 accept frames 160–300.
▶ What is the maximum output torque of the WPDX?
The WPDX size 250 delivers 850–3,025 Nm at 1/5–1/60 ratio — the same as the WPDA size 250 since the worm gear internals are identical. D+X configuration affects mounting only, not torque capacity.
